Orioles Exec VP/Business Operations DOUG DUENNES, who "oversaw all aspects of Camden Yards and the business side of the Orioles in his two-plus years" in the position, "has been relieved of his duties." Duennes said, "There really wasn't an explanation ... It was said a 'change in direction,' that kind of language." He "had more than 30 years of experience" working in MLB, including previous stints with the Padres and Dodgers (BALTIMORESUN.com, 7/30).

ACROSS THE ATLANTIC: The Atlantic 10 announced that Senior Associate Commissioner ED PASQUE will be handling the league's external brand management and marketing endeavors while continuing his oversight of the A-10 media partner contract relationships. The conference also promoted LUCAS FELLER to Assistant Commissioner for Championships and TOM WATERMAN to Operations Assistant for Championships & Media Relations, and named HENRY ARCHULETA to the newly created position of Compliance Dir (A-10).

: The Int'l Association of Venue Managers named BOK Center GM JOHN BOLTON Chair, with a one-year term (TULSA WORLD, 7/30)....NASCAR named CHRIS WRIGHT K&N Pro Series East Dir and transitioned KIP CHILDRESS to K&N Pro Series West Dir. The series also named TONY GLOVER NASCAR Touring Series Technical Dir. K&N Pro Series West interim Dir LES WESTERFIELD will resume his role as NASCAR Touring Series Technical Coordinator and K&N Pro Series East race Dir (NASCAR)....Hendrick Motorsports named VP/Development DOUG DUCHARDT to the newly created position of Exec VP & GM. He will be in charge of all racing operations, and will report to team Owner RICK HENDRICK and President MARSHALL CARLSON (Hendrick).
